The Metford Files.

Tough private eye Lee Metford investigates bizarre mysteries and strange crimes on the Indian frontiers of the British Empire. With his Pathan driver, Webley, a trained martial artist and ex-Thugee cultist, they travel the border towns on public transport and mule trains. Keeping the Empire safe, fighting off Afghan tribes, thwarting Imperial Russian provocateurs and putting down mutinies, Lee Metford is the man to turn to when things go bad.

 

Co-staring Verne Troyer as Young Ghandi

Hero at Large

Steve Nichols is a poor struggling actor trying to eke out a living in Depression era New York. He gets job promoting a new movie serial charcter called the Dark Phantom. While in his costume he foils a robbery at the corner grocery store and it makes radio news. Soon everyone is talking about the real life pulp hero and waiting to hear what he does next. And in the offices the Mayor's city council a certain opportunistic PR Man is also interested.
